
IHG Hotels & Resorts and Felix Capital have revealed they will build Crowne Plaza Maroochydore, with construction to commence in early 2026 and completion in 2028.
The hotel will feature more than 770 square metres of flexible meetings and events space, including the 600-square-metre ballroom.
Crowne Plaza Maroochydore will also feature a 210-seat all-day restaurant; a 160-seat signature dining venue; an outdoor pool bar and lounge; a lobby bar; a 30-metre pool and spa; wellness retreat; gym; sauna; and secure basement parking.
The project has been reimagined from a previous concept for voco Maroochydore.

It is estimated the Sunshine Coast requires 2400 additional hotel rooms – approximately 10 new hotels – by 2032 to support the region’s economic development.

The project marks the second collaboration between IHG Hotels & Resorts and Felix Capital, following the 2024 signing of Holiday Inn & Suites Caloundra, which is set to open in 2030.
